Decisive Factors -Vending machines are a profitable business, however location is the decisive factor in the whole market. For example, you and a competitor have machines crammed with similar things and they are side by side at the same location. Let's say they are both crammed with snack cakes and candy bars.
Who's going to sell the most in the shortest amount of time? Folks going to the gym are usually making an attempt to stay fit and are less likely to get junk food, whereas bar goers may be prone to having a snack with their drink. In brief, the location of a vending machine can build or break your business.
Business Beginnings - Deciding on what things to sell is the primary task at hand. There are machines capable of selling toys, hot dogs, soda, juice, coffee, ice cream, pizza, and sandwiches.
By contacting local vendors, you may get an idea of what difficulties they may be having or have had in the past. They can inform you of troubles with specific machines and you may also know what things they're currently selling.
